E-residents contributed €67.4M to the Estonian state treasury in 2023

In 2023, tax revenues from e-residents’ Estonian companies amounted to a record €64.3 million, a 33% increase from the previous year. Including paid state fees, the programme’s annual contribution to the state treasury reached €67.4 million.

Applications open for Mega Green Accelerator, to support climate solutions by regional startups

The Mega Green Accelerator is now open for applications from startups in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region that focus on circular economy solutions, clean energy transition and climate mitigation technologies, including water and agriculture. The initiative will nurture the next generation of innovators as they develop solutions to address both regional and global sustainability challenges. PepsiCo and SABIC have partnered with AstroLabs, as well as with other strategic partners to create the program, which was announced at COP28 in the UAE.
